The FIBA Women's EuroBasket 2027 logo was unveiled for the Qualifiers draw

    A dynamic new visual identity was presented ahead of the start of the FIBA Women's EuroBasket 2027 campaign.

    MUNICH (Germany) - The official logo for FIBA Women's EuroBasket 2027 has been unveiled, marking a major milestone on the road to the 41st edition of Europe's flagship women's basketball competition.

    Bold and expressive, the new logo embodies the tournament's motto – Dare to Dream. Featuring strong typography and stark contrasts, the design strips away ornamentation in favor of raw attitude and emotion, capturing the essence of women's basketball: speed, team spirit, energy, and passion.

    "The launch of the FIBA Women's EuroBasket 2027 logo is an important step on the road to our flagship event," said FIBA Executive Director Europe, Kamil Novak.

    "In close cooperation with the four host nations, we've created a bold and contemporary identity that mirrors the spirit of women's basketball today and inspires our athletes to be bold, fearless and push the boundaries of what is possible."

    The announcement comes ahead of the FIBA Women's EuroBasket 2027 Qualifiers Draw on July 23, which will set the stage for an exciting journey towards the Final Round.

    A total of 38 national teams will compete in the qualification campaign, which gets underway later this year, with 16 teams earning the right to participate in the Final Round over the course of four windows in November 2025, March 2026, November 2026 and February 2027.

    FIBA Women's EuroBasket 2027 will be co-hosted by the national federations of Belgium, Finland, Lithuania, and Sweden.

    The Group Phase will be played in Antwerp, Belgium; Espoo, Finland; Stockholm, Sweden; Klaipeda, Lithuania, while the Final Phase is taking place in the Lithuanian capital, Vilnius.

    ### About FIBA Women's EuroBasket 2027 FIBA Women's EuroBasket 2027 will mark the 41st edition of the continental showpiece event, and will see 16 teams fight for the coveted title.
